
| While visiting one of her daughters on the west cost, Janet Habansky had the opportunity to attend a First Friday Art Walk. This unique experience sparked an idea. She realized that Black Rock, historically known for its artistic community, would be a perfect match for a First Friday Art Walk of it's own. In 2004, Janet organized the first First Friday season, taking place along Fairfield Avenue in the Black Rock Entertainment District. Since then First Friday's have grown in popularity with an outpouring of new artists and patrons. Art Walk brings together vendors from the Fairfield County Area and beyond. From photos to paintings to jewelry, there is a wide collection of various media that is made by each exhibitor. Now in it's 4th season, the Art Walk Board decided it was time the event was brought to the next level. With the launch of a website and a new name, the Art Walk is bringing the arts back to Bridgeport. Art Walks will take place on the first and third Friday's of the month.
